The off-lead appears either in the leading left corner, or straight below the lead on the right. To "hide the lead"is to start the post with background info or information of secondary significance to the readers, forcing them to learn more deeply into a short article than they need to need to in order to find the vital factors. Usual usage is that a person or two sentences each develop their own paragraph. Journalists generally describe the organization or framework of a news story as an upside down pyramid. The necessary and most fascinating components of a tale are placed at the start, with sustaining info complying with in order of decreasing significance. It allows individuals to explore a subject to just the depth that their inquisitiveness takes them, and without the charge of details or subtleties that they can think about unimportant, however still making that information offered to extra interested visitors. The inverted pyramid structure likewise allows posts to be cut to any arbitrary size throughout format, to suit the room readily available. Some writers begin their tales with the"1-2-3 lead", yet there are many kinds of lead offered. This layout inevitably starts with a"Five Ws"opening up paragraph (as described above ), complied with by an indirect quote that offers to support a major aspect of the first paragraph, and afterwards a straight quote to support the indirect quote. As late as the early 1800s, newspapers were still quite costly to print. Day-to-day papers had ended up being extra typical and offered sellers up-to-date, important trading details, a lot of were valued at regarding 6 cents a copywell over what artisans and other working-class citizens might afford. Paper readership was limited to the elite.


Printed on tiny, letter-sized pages, The Sunlight marketed for just a cent. International News Online. With the Industrial Transformation in full swing, Day employed the new steam-driven, two-cylinder press to publish The Sun. While the old printing machine was qualified of printing around 125 documents per hour, this highly boosted variation published roughly 18,000 copies per hour


He printed the paper's motto at the top of every front web page of The Sunlight: "The item of this paper is to lay prior to the public, at a rate within the ways of each, all the information of the day, and at the very same time use a useful medium for promotions (Starr, 2004)." The Sunlight sought tales that would certainly appeal to the brand-new mainstream consumer.
